UPVC Window Repairs

Replacement-Windows-150x150.jpguPVC windows are energy efficient and can help to reduce heating bills. However, as they get older, issues can develop that require repair. This could include damaged hinges, handles or locks.

Wooden window repair is fairly easy for DIY enthusiasts to complete themselves. It can be cheaper than buying a new window.

Cracks

Cracks and fractures can pose a serious problem. Windows that are not repaired can lead to water intrusion and weaker barriers to cold weather, and even structural damage. Find an expert local builder that specializes in repairing uPVC frames. They should have the required skills and experience, as well as the equipment needed to get the best results. This will ensure that your crack is repaired before it worsens and you don't need to replace your window glass or unit.

There are many home-based solutions that can be used to repair small cracks in glass. Superglue and masking tape are two of the most commonly used products used to keep glass window repair that has cracked in place for a short period of time. For deeper cracks, tape may need be extended on both sides.

You can also make use of two-part epoxy to fix broken or cracked glasses. It is available at most hardware stores and is available for around $10. Make sure your workspace is prepared prior to mixing the epoxy and make sure you have the proper tool for the job for example, a soldering tool.

Water Leaks

If your uPVC window is leaking, it could ruin your interior and cause costly repairs. Water leaks may also cause structural damage to your home, as well as mold growth. To prevent damage, it's important to address any issues caused by windows that leak immediately.

A damaged sealant around window frames is a common reason for leaks. The use of silicone caulking can bring the condition of the seal back to its normal condition and Double Glazed Window Repairs stop water leakage. Look for gaps and cracks around the window frame and also the brick or stone wall surrounding your windows.

A blocked drainage hole or faulty flashing are the other two common causes of leaking windows. It's important to check that the drainage holes are clear and free of obstruction, particularly after a heavy rainstorm. Also, you should check the windows' flashing to ensure that it's properly sealed.

It's also important to check that your drip cap does not have any decay or is missing. A rotted drip cap or one that's missing will allow water from above to enter your window and cause structural damage. Replacing drip caps isn't difficult and is generally a simple process of purchasing the new one and putting it in the right spot.

A professional can also test your windows for watertightness. They can employ a tool to test the water-tightness of your windows and ensure that they meet industry standards. If your windows fail the test, you'll need to replace them. This is a costly fix however it's worth it for the comfort and safety of your family.

Broken Hinges

There will be a problem opening or closing your uPVC windows in the event that the hinges are damaged or aren't working properly. This could be a security risk and also prevent your home from staying warm or cold. It's easy to get a new window hinge for your uPVC windows. But, it's crucial to ensure that you have the right hinge for your windows.

The hinges have to be the same size in order to fit inside the window frame. The most commonly used hinge used in uPVC windows is a standard 18mm or 15mm UPVC window hinge. There are also special hinges for wooden frames. Getting the correct type of window hinge for your windows will aid in avoiding common problems that many homeowners encounter with their windows, such as not closing properly.

The hinges on your windows may be loose or stiff due to a variety of reasons. The hinges might not be sufficiently tightened. You can test this using a screwdriver to locate the friction screw on the other side of the hinge, and then loosen it. After that, you can adjust it by twisting it in any direction until you achieve the desired result.

Faulty locks

UPVC window locks and mechanism are an essential component of the security of your home, they make it very difficult to open the window without breaking. When a lock fails, it could be frustrating, however it's an simple fix and you don't need to replace the entire window.

Most of the time, it's an issue that could have been prevented if you have had regular maintenance. We suggest that you have your uPVC window cleaned regularly as part of our annual maintenance package in order to reduce the likelihood of any issues.

The majority of modern uPVC windows come with espagnolette locks which operate by pushing the nose of the handle across a wedge block then turning the handle to close the lock. They are extremely efficient in keeping windows secure, but over time, they could begin to fail if they're not properly maintained - we recommend applying WD-40 to the lock at least once per year.

If you notice that your uPVC windows aren't opening or shut as easily as they used too, or when the lock isn't functioning properly, it is likely that there is a problem with the gearbox that locks the window glass repair near me frame. The process of removing this gearbox can be difficult because it requires the removal of the seals around the frame and removing the handle (be cautious not to damage these).

A locksmith who specialises in UPVC repairs has the knowledge to quickly identify the issue and will then be able to replace the failed locking gearbox with an exact replacement. This is a quick and simple fix that could save you hundreds of dollars by cutting out the need to purchase new windows.
